Paralegal – Franchise & Corporate Operations
101 Mobility is a leading provider of mobility and accessibility solutions, offering products such as stairlifts, elevators, ramps, and more. The Paralegal – Franchise & Corporate Operations plays a key role in supporting the legal, compliance, and documentation needs of the franchise development and corporate operations teams, ensuring consistency, accuracy, and compliance across the system.

Responsibilities
Support the franchise development process by preparing, tracking, and managing franchise-related legal documentation, including franchise agreements, amendments, transfers, renewals, and related materials
Assist with preparation, updates, and annual maintenance of Franchise Disclosure Documents (FDDs). Coordinate state franchise registrations, renewals, exemptions, and compliance filings in collaboration with outside counsel
Support legal aspects of new franchise sales, ensuring documentation is complete, executed accurately, and retained in accordance with company standards and regulatory requirements
Independently manage assigned projects, deadlines, and compliance calendars, proactively identifying issues and ensuring timely resolution with minimal supervision
Work closely with franchise development, operations, finance, and leadership to align legal documentation and processes with business objectives
Serve as a point of contact for franchisees for routine franchise documentation and compliance questions, ensuring consistency and professionalism
Assist with entity management, corporate records, and internal legal documentation as needed to support overall corporate operations
Help develop, document, and refine franchise and legal processes, templates, and systems to support a scalable and efficient franchise development function
